Here is our itinerary:

 

8:00 in port, off ship

8:30 Private Tour pick-up with Malta Travelnet

9:00 – 9:45 AM: Mdina (we normally visit this site for 1hr)

Medina is a medieval walled city, nicknamed "the Silent City. The walled city of Mdina is very small - only a long city block long and wide, I'd say. There were several streets each way, but very short blocks. Mdina Medieval City (walking tour or tour by horse drawn cabs - traditional mode of transport know as the karozzin)

9:45 – 10:15 AM: drive to Blue Grotto

10:15 – 12:00 AM: boat trip and quick swim stunning Blue Grotto (here you can grab a boat trip that takes through a series of coastal caves which are really stunning).

12:00 – 12:30 PM: drive to Valletta try to grab a snack or light lunch. Tour of the Upper Barraka Gardens.

12:30 – 1:45 PM: Valletta/St. John's Co. Cathedral (09.30hrs to 16.30hrs) Adults €5.80 Senior €4.65 Student: €3.50 Children under 12 Free The entrance fee includes the provision of handheld audio guides with 24 stops

*****proper dress no bare shoulders//high heels

 

1400hrs return to ship

Entrance fees - PAID LOCALLY and are OPTIONAL:

St. John's Co. Cathedral is EUR5.82 per person,

Blue Grotto is EUR7.00 per person and you will need 3 cabbies if you want to do the horse drawn cab trip around Mdina, this will amount to EUR120.00/10 (for all of you) = EUR12.00 per person
